#### When to Visit Sobetsu\n
Planning for the weather is a good way to make your trip to Sobetsu relaxing and enjoyable, especially when you’re splurging. The hottest months are usually August and July, with an average temperature of 19°C, while the coldest months are February and January, with an average of -2°C. The snowiest months in Sobetsu are January, February, March and December, with each month seeing an average of 77 cm of snowfall.
What's there to see and do in Sobetsu?
Enjoy Sobetsu with a stop at Lake Toya, Toyako Onsen and Shikotsu-Toya National Park. If you have a bit of extra time while you’re in the area, you might want to check out Sobetsu Samuzu Road Station and Sobetsujohokanai.
